IN MEMORIAM: WALT VAN CAMPEN

United Paws of Tillamook and the animals of Tillamook County have lost a longtime dear friend, Walter Van Campen. He passed away after several years of serious illness. Walt was a gentle, talented, compassionate, and mostly humble man. Long before we all had phone cameras, Walt was a photographer, capturing the grace and elegance in the natural world—a world he often saw as complicated and cruel, yet still beautiful.

Walt's photos are his legacy. Feral cats were his special love, creating stunning images that showcase the cats' independence, beauty, and remarkable resilience. For many years, Walt was dedicated to helping United Paws find homes for so many of its rescued cats. His remarkable photography was his number one skill for photographing and helping cats in need. Co-founder of United Paws, Patti Bumgarner, was a longtime friend of Walt's and they worked together rescuing cats for years. She said, "United Paws will forever be grateful to Walt for his help and his stunning photography. He will be greatly missed." Patti submitted some of Walt's photographs, included in this post.
